Output 0652050a14624069c40e0ad3998cf3b455687c88f8e26f5805ba2ad666f3254f:0

value
644143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ba13a8eaefb5eab2ea3fd719fdc92a216581c85f OP_EQUALVERIFY OP_CHECKSIG
address
1HxtEfqySx2jaCxvgFqSHnhgH1ziUKoLX8
transaction
0652050a14624069c40e0ad3998cf3b455687c88f8e26f5805ba2ad666f3254f
spent
true